public class WorkflowRunActionRepetitionDefinitionInner
extends com.azure.core.management.Resource
Constructor and Description |
---|
WorkflowRunActionRepetitionDefinitionInner() |
Modifier and Type | Method and Description |
---|---|
String |
code()
Get the code property: The workflow scope repetition code.
|
RunActionCorrelation |
correlation()
Get the correlation property: The correlation properties.
|
OffsetDateTime |
endTime()
Get the endTime property: The end time of the workflow scope repetition.
|
Object |
error()
Get the error property: Any object.
|
Object |
inputs()
Get the inputs property: Gets the inputs.
|
ContentLink |
inputsLink()
Get the inputsLink property: Gets the link to inputs.
|
Integer |
iterationCount()
Get the iterationCount property: The iterationCount property.
|
Object |
outputs()
Get the outputs property: Gets the outputs.
|
ContentLink |
outputsLink()
Get the outputsLink property: Gets the link to outputs.
|
List<RepetitionIndex> |
repetitionIndexes()
Get the repetitionIndexes property: The repetition indexes.
|
List<RetryHistory> |
retryHistory()
Get the retryHistory property: Gets the retry histories.
|
OffsetDateTime |
startTime()
Get the startTime property: The start time of the workflow scope repetition.
|
WorkflowStatus |
status()
Get the status property: The status of the workflow scope repetition.
|
Object |
trackedProperties()
Get the trackedProperties property: Gets the tracked properties.
|
String |
trackingId()
Get the trackingId property: Gets the tracking id.
|
void |
validate()
Validates the instance.
|
WorkflowRunActionRepetitionDefinitionInner |
withCode(String code)
Set the code property: The workflow scope repetition code.
|
WorkflowRunActionRepetitionDefinitionInner |
withCorrelation(RunActionCorrelation correlation)
Set the correlation property: The correlation properties.
|
WorkflowRunActionRepetitionDefinitionInner |
withEndTime(OffsetDateTime endTime)
Set the endTime property: The end time of the workflow scope repetition.
|
WorkflowRunActionRepetitionDefinitionInner |
withError(Object error)
Set the error property: Any object.
|
WorkflowRunActionRepetitionDefinitionInner |
withIterationCount(Integer iterationCount)
Set the iterationCount property: The iterationCount property.
|
WorkflowRunActionRepetitionDefinitionInner |
withLocation(String location) |
WorkflowRunActionRepetitionDefinitionInner |
withRepetitionIndexes(List<RepetitionIndex> repetitionIndexes)
Set the repetitionIndexes property: The repetition indexes.
|
WorkflowRunActionRepetitionDefinitionInner |
withRetryHistory(List<RetryHistory> retryHistory)
Set the retryHistory property: Gets the retry histories.
|
WorkflowRunActionRepetitionDefinitionInner |
withStartTime(OffsetDateTime startTime)
Set the startTime property: The start time of the workflow scope repetition.
|
WorkflowRunActionRepetitionDefinitionInner |
withStatus(WorkflowStatus status)
Set the status property: The status of the workflow scope repetition.
|
WorkflowRunActionRepetitionDefinitionInner |
withTags(Map<String,String> tags) |
public WorkflowRunActionRepetitionDefinitionInner()
public OffsetDateTime startTime()
public WorkflowRunActionRepetitionDefinitionInner withStartTime(OffsetDateTime startTime)
startTime
- the startTime value to set.public OffsetDateTime endTime()
public WorkflowRunActionRepetitionDefinitionInner withEndTime(OffsetDateTime endTime)
endTime
- the endTime value to set.public RunActionCorrelation correlation()
public WorkflowRunActionRepetitionDefinitionInner withCorrelation(RunActionCorrelation correlation)
correlation
- the correlation value to set.public WorkflowStatus status()
public WorkflowRunActionRepetitionDefinitionInner withStatus(WorkflowStatus status)
status
- the status value to set.public String code()
public WorkflowRunActionRepetitionDefinitionInner withCode(String code)
code
- the code value to set.public Object error()
public WorkflowRunActionRepetitionDefinitionInner withError(Object error)
error
- the error value to set.public String trackingId()
public Object inputs()
public ContentLink inputsLink()
public Object outputs()
public ContentLink outputsLink()
public Object trackedProperties()
public List<RetryHistory> retryHistory()
public WorkflowRunActionRepetitionDefinitionInner withRetryHistory(List<RetryHistory> retryHistory)
retryHistory
- the retryHistory value to set.public Integer iterationCount()
public WorkflowRunActionRepetitionDefinitionInner withIterationCount(Integer iterationCount)
iterationCount
- the iterationCount value to set.public List<RepetitionIndex> repetitionIndexes()
public WorkflowRunActionRepetitionDefinitionInner withRepetitionIndexes(List<RepetitionIndex> repetitionIndexes)
repetitionIndexes
- the repetitionIndexes value to set.public WorkflowRunActionRepetitionDefinitionInner withLocation(String location)
withLocation
in class com.azure.core.management.Resource
public WorkflowRunActionRepetitionDefinitionInner withTags(Map<String,String> tags)
withTags
in class com.azure.core.management.Resource
public void validate()
IllegalArgumentException
- thrown if the instance is not valid.Copyright © 2021 Microsoft Corporation. All rights reserved.